Lengthening days in Tokyo through June 1956
In Tokyo, Japan, June 1956 is a month when the day lengthens: from 14h 24m at the start to 14h 32m by the end, a swing of about 8 minutes. That works out to roughly 2 minutes a week.
The earliest sunrise falls at 04:24 on June 11 and the latest at 04:28 on June 29, while sunset ranges from 18:51 on June 1 to 19:00 on June 22.

What is the difference between sunrise and sunset?
Sunrise is the moment the sun's top edge first appears above the horizon in the morning; sunset is when it disappears below the horizon in the evening. The gap between them is the day's length, which shifts gradually through the year.

Are the sunrise and sunset times for Tokyo accurate?
Times are calculated from the location's exact latitude, longitude and time zone using standard astronomical algorithms, accurate to about a minute. Local terrain such as hills or tall buildings can slightly shift when the sun actually appears or disappears.
